Overgrown shrubs blocking windows or walkways

easy 1–3 h

Steps

  1. Check the plant type: spring-flowering shrubs are pruned right after flowering; most others in late winter. Evergreens tolerate light trimming any time.

+4 more steps in the full guide

Stop and call a pro if

  • the shrub is near power lines or higher than you can reach from the ground
